2 Mun Ho
Issuer | Korea (1392-1945) |
Year | 1742 |
Type | Standard circulation coin |
Value | 2 Mun (0.002) |
Currency | Mun (1392-1892) |
Composition | Bronze |
Weight | 5.6 g |
Dimensions | 30 mm |
Thickness | 1 mm |
Shape and Technique | Round with a square hole Cast |
Orientation | Medal alignment ↑↑ |
Engraver(s) | |
In circulation to | |
Reference(s) | KM#80 |
Obverse description | -Top to Bottom : 常平 (Sang Pyeong) -Right to Left : 通寶 (Tong Bo) |
Obverse script | |
Obverse lettering | ㅤ常
寶 通
平 (Translation: 常 (Sang): Always 平 (pyong): Constant 通 (Tong): Circulation 寶 (Bo): Treasure) |
Reverse description | -Top : 户 (Ho) -Bottom : 玄 (Hyun) |
Reverse script | |
Reverse lettering | 户
玄 (Translation: 户 (Ho): Treasury Department 玄 (Hyun): Series ``Black``) |
Edge | |
Mint | 户 Treasury Department (户曹 (Hojo)),modern-day Seoul, South Korea (1678-1883) |
Mintage | ND (1742) 户 - Series Black (玄) -
